服务器虚拟化是一种通过软件将物理服务器资源划分为多个独立虚拟机的技术,使得每个虚拟机都能运行自己的操作系统和应用程序。这种技术有效提高了硬件资源的利用率,降低了IT基础设施的成本。
在实际应用中,企业可以利用服务器虚拟化来简化系统管理,提高灵活性。例如,当需要部署新应用时,无需购买新的物理服务器,而是可以在现有服务器上快速创建虚拟机。
虚拟化技术的核心在于虚拟机监控程序(Hypervisor),它负责分配和管理物理资源,并确保各个虚拟机之间互不干扰。常见的Hypervisor包括VMware ESXi、Microsoft Hyper-V和KVM等。
除了提升效率,服务器虚拟化还增强了系统的可用性和灾难恢复能力。通过快照、迁移等功能,管理员可以在不影响业务的情况下进行维护或应对故障。
AI绘图结果,仅供参考
随着云计算的发展,服务器虚拟化成为构建云环境的重要基础。它支持动态资源分配,使企业能够根据需求灵活调整计算资源。
尽管虚拟化带来了诸多优势,但也需要注意安全性和性能优化。合理规划虚拟机数量、定期更新系统补丁以及采用合适的网络隔离措施,都是保障虚拟化环境稳定运行的关键。